Job Description
Primary responsibilities of the Patient Financial Services Clerk include posting all insurance payments received to patient accounts, client payment posting and self- pay payment posting. Validate, and correct as needed, auto-posted electronic payments. Separates and monitors files for all insurance companies so readily available for fiscal year end needs.
Essential Job Functions
- Posts accounts receivable insurance money daily in an accurate and timely manner.
- Responsible to make sure that batches are accurate and payments post to the correct account.
- Reconciles bank deposits to the daily receipts and oversees that deposits are completed daily.
- Reviews remittance advices and determines significant problems causing rejection or denial and notifies billing staff.
- Responsible for client billing and shadow billing tasks.
- Distribute claims denials to appropriate biller for review and correction.
- Responsible for reviewing and processing accounts with insurance credits.
- Responsible for ordering department supplies.
- Responsible for submitting service requests to EHR vendor relating to billing.
- Responsible for business office customer service-answer phones, handles patient and staff inquiries in a professional and effective manner.
- Receives money on accounts from patients who present to the window and helps answer front window questions.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
